JUSTICE RAJENDRA KUMAR MISHRA ORAL ORDER 11-07-2016 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ned A.P.P. for the State.

The petitioner is accused in connection with Muffasil P.S. Case No. 329 of 2015 registered under Section 302/34 of the Indian Penal Code.

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that petitioner is not named in the F.I.R. rather in course of investigation only suspicion has been raised by the brother of the informant which would appear in paragraphs 19 and 20 of the case diary to the effect that the deceased was seen with this petitioner except that there is nothing against him. It is further submitted that petitioner has no criminal antecedent and is in custody since 28.11.2015. It is further submitted that similarly situated co-

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.27564 of 2016 (2) dt.11-07-2016 accused, Vishwanath Choudhary, has already been granted privilege of bail by a Bench of this Court vide order dated 28.04.2016 passed in Criminal Misc. No. 17603 of 2016. Having regard to the facts and the circumstances of the case, the petitioner above named, is directed to be released on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s.10,000/-(Rupees Ten Th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the Judicial Magistrate Ist Class, Motihari, in connection with Muffasil P.S. Case No. 329 of 2015. Out of two sureties, one surety must be the close relative of the petitioner. (Rajendra Kumar Mishra, J) Bhardwaj/- U T
